I picked this up as a fun resto project for my USN Veteran husband.  It came from a fellow who runs estate sales; he said it didn't sell several years ago but it was too cool to scrap so it's been in his garage. I can find no markings on it, and would love to know the era of it, the weight it would've been as loaded, and likely color scheme. We'd like to restore it as closely as possible to original. Your help is greatly appreciated! 

Overall Height: 37.75"   Ring Diameter: 14"   Fin Height: 9.5" outside 19.5" where it meets the body.
